Back in the '90s I picked up a couple of 16mm projectors from a school auction so I could play some old movies I had acquired.
I hadn't touched them since, but noticed how cheap movies go for on ebay so I'm starting to build a collection. I'm installing a new motor belt for the other unit since that seemed to have gone bad over the years, so that one is in a bunch of pieces right now, but the other one still works!
I had to create a converter cable to take the audio out of the only jack available, which was meant for an actual speaker. So, I created an attenuator with a 1K and 10K resistor, patched it through the line-in jack on my field recorder and then into the Nikon. I played a few snippets from a pile of old classroom films from the LA school district in this video
